I did a trial with horse chestnuts (the fruits of Aesculus hippocastanum). The crabs were offered a cracked chestnut once per week for the last month, but they never touched it. The nuts always were fresh, I'm going to try and offer chestnuts that are already dried, a week old, or maybe sprouted, if I can get them to germinate.
Edible chestnuts (Castanea sp.) were eaten by my crabs, although not with much enthusiasm.
